**[PUNCHCARD-2291] Loyalty ledger vault locked after failed migration**

Hey — quick one before you approve the PR. The Punchcard points ledger vault auto-locked when the migration job retried three times, so staging reconciliation is frozen. I've reverted the schema change; the diff is tiny, promise. To unseal and rerun the balance checks, use the vault recovery flow. Paste in the recovery passphrase below when prompted.

recovery phrase for bawef-kagug: casix-tamvan-lamath-holeth-gilmir-drudor-julax-wenok-wenael-rusvan-holax-goriel-frawyn

### Runbook: Upload Encoding Detection

When the Textgrove ingest worker flags an upload as "encoding unknown," the sniffer logs a confidence score to the diagnostics table. Scores under 0.6 trigger manual review. Check the last ten flagged rows before approving a release. Query the diagnostics database with the connection string below.

primary connection of yagep-kahip = redis://giliel_svc:zYiKsLL2PLpfPL@db-348f.xolmarsys.corp:5432/fenwyn

Ticket: Drift in the Marginalia markdown pipeline

Hey — quick one for you. The Marginalia renderer on staging has drifted from what's in the repo; someone tweaked the sanitizer and footnote settings by hand a while back and never committed. Rendering now differs between environments, which is confusing customers. Could you reconcile? Staging is currently running with this configuration:

config for yajep-tafof:
[rusath]
team = julmir
access_code = ac_fe37fd
host = rusath.novactech.test
port = 8000
owner = pelmir.weneth
peer = oliwyn.olvarqdyn.internal

Quarterly Planning Note

For the incoming director: the Branwick Partners term sheet is in final review. Valuation and board seat provisions are settled; the outstanding issue is the drag-along threshold. Legal expects closure within three weeks. Q2 planning assumes funds land mid-quarter, so model both scenarios. Our confidential business plan summary is set out below.

confidential, bafof-bawip: Sordorox Logistics is in early talks to buy Sorixox Systems for about $17.6 million. The Jorox launch date is January 3, and nothing goes to the press before then.